Harbour Island - A local pilot guides us yards from the beach as we
navigate the shallow waters of the Devil's Backbone into Harbour
Island. The island is renowned for its brightly colored houses and
eloquent white picket fences. It's a great place to soak up the
colorful culture of the islands. If fishing or diving is your passion,
local knowledge of some of the worlds most beautiful reefs will ensure
you a catch of the day that can be prepared for dinner. Diving offers
an unusual train wreck or a speedy drift dive with the tide through
current cut.
Day 4:
Harbour Island - Colored pink by millions of coral fragments, a wide
three mile long sandy beach awaits you for an exciting day of water
sports and sunbathing. Whilst enjoying the beach we serve you a
spectacular buffet style picnic lunch. Golf carts are the means of
transportation around Harbour Island and will allow you to explore the
many narrow streets. Take the opportunity to dine at one of the many
unique restaurants and experiencing the night life with a little local
flare is a must.
